Oistins Fish Festival in Oistins
An Easter-weekend street fair in the fishing town of Oistins built around competitions drawn directly from fishermen's working skills, fish boning, dolphin skinning, boat races, a greasy pole, layered onto the site of the 1652 treaty that ended Barbados's civil-war standoff. Expect market stalls, fried fish, and a working-harbor crowd rather than a polished event ground.
Oistins Fish Festival runs every Easter weekend on the site where the 1652 Charter of Barbados was signed, a treaty that ended a civil-war-era standoff between Royalist and Parliamentarian factions on the island.
